
Commercial Loan Underwriting
Commercial loan underwriting is the process lenders use to assess the risk of providing a loan to a business. During underwriting, lenders evaluate the company's financial health, credit history, and ability to repay the loan, including analyzing cash flow, assets, and the purpose of the loan. This thorough review helps ensure that the business can meet its obligations, ultimately protecting both the lender and the borrower. A successful underwriting process leads to informed lending decisions, helping businesses secure the funding they need for growth or operations.
